完整解析Zblog开发:从入门到精通的实用指南

完整解析Zblog开发:从入门到精通的实用指南Zblog作为一个开源的博客平台,为用户提供了丰富的功能与灵活的开发环境。无论是个人站长还是企业用户,都可以通过Zblog搭建自己的网站。尽管有这些因素,...

完整解析Zblog开发:从入门到精通的实用指南

Zblog作为一个开源的博客平台,为用户提供了丰富的功能与灵活的开发环境。无论是个人站长还是企业用户,都可以通过Zblog搭建自己的网站。尽管有这些因素,要真正深入掌握Zblog的开发,本文将为你提供一个完整的指导,从入门基础到高级开发技巧,让你在Zblog的世界里游刃有余。

完整解析Zblog开发:从入门到精通的实用指南

Zblog概述

Zblog是一个基于PHP和MySQL的轻量级博客系统,采用模块化设计,方便扩展和定制。用户可以通过简单的设置来创建和管理自己的博客,如果需要进行更深层次的开发,Zblog也提供了丰富的API和文档支援。

环境搭建

在开始Zblog开发之前,首先考虑的是需要搭建开发环境。一般来说,你需要以下几项工具:

  • Web服务器:Apache或Nginx
  • 资料库:MySQL
  • PHP:推荐使用7.0及以上版本

安装完成后,下载Zblog的最新版本,解压后将其放置在Web服务器的根目录下,随后通过浏览器访问,即可启动安装向导,完成安装。

基本设置与管理

安装成功后,你将进入Zblog的后台管理界面。这里可以进行各种设置,包括网站信息、主题选择、插件管理等。首先考虑的是,你需要设置基本信息,如网站名称、描述及关键词,这些信息将影响SEO表现。接下来,可以根据需求选择合适的主题,Zblog官方提供了多种免费主题供用户选择。

完整解析Zblog开发:从入门到精通的实用指南

主题开发

如果你想要更加无与伦比的网站外观,可以尝试自己开发主题。Zblog的主题使用HTML和CSS构建,结合PHP模板语言。开发主题的基本步骤如下:

  1. 创建主题文件夹:在Zblog的“theme”目录下创建一个新文件夹,命名为你的主题名。
  2. 准备必要文件:你的主题至少需要一个index.php文件,它是网站的主页。与此同时,你还可以添加其他页面文件,如header.php和footer.php。
  3. 设计样式:使用CSS来制定网站的样式,确保网站在不同设备上的兼容性。

完成后,将主题上传至服务器并在后台进行启用,这样你就可以看到自己的主题后果了。

插件开发

除了主题,Zblog的功能也可以通过插件进行扩展。插件是Zblog的一大优势,它可以给你的站点新增各类功能,如SEO优化、社交分享等。开发插件的步骤如下:

  1. 创建插件文件夹:在Zblog的“plugin”目录下创建一个新文件夹。
  2. 编写插件代码:每个插件必须包含一个主PHP文件,这个文件将包含插件的基本信息及达成目标功能的代码。
  3. 安装插件:在后台的插件管理页面中上传并启用插件,即可激活新的功能。

资料管理与API使用

Zblog为开发者提供了强大的API支援,方便你进行资料的管理和操作。你可以通过API获取文章、评论、分类等资料,也可以创建、修改和删除相应的资料。使用API的基本方法是:

  1. 查阅Zblog官方API文档,了解各类接口的使用。
  2. 使用cURL或者HTTP库发送请求,获取资料。
  3. 对返回的资料进行解决,展示在你的主题或实践中。

前端交互与功能增强

为了提升用户体验,你还可以在Zblog中加入各种前端交互后果,比如AJAX刷新评论、异步加载文章等。这些功能可以提升用户的访问体验,让网站更加生动。你可以使用JavaScript和jQuery等库来达成目标这些功能,通过调用Zblog的API进行资料交互。

维护与优化

当你的网站搭建完成后,定期的维护与优化是必不可少的。要保证网站的流畅性和安全性,你可以考虑以下几点:

  • 定期备份网站资料及资料库。
  • 及时更新Zblog及其插件,保护网站免受安全漏洞的影响。
  • 监测网站流量和性能,对页面进行优化,提升加载速度。

总结

通过本文的介绍,相信你对Zblog的开发有了更深入的了解。从环境搭建到主题与插件开发,再到资料管理与维护,每一步都是构建一个成功网站的关键。无论你是新手还是有经验的开发者,持续学习和实践将使你在Zblog的开发道路上越走越远。希望本指南能够帮助你在Zblog的世界中创造出属于自己的精彩。

上一篇:深入解析zblog统计功能:提升网站信息研究效率
下一篇:ZBlog多用户博客系统:便捷搭建个人与团队博客的对策

为您推荐

Sitemap.html